The Freelance Economy Examined Through LinkedIn Data
1. The world of freelance has been getting bigger
and bigger in the past few years. Building your
own startup company, be it a physical office or
a strong online presence, is easy when you
have the right marketing strategy and create
relationships on the right networking sites. A
bulk of the working class has either given up
their nine to five for a home-based gig and/or
take up projects part time to earn extra
income. With this in mind, we took a look at a
recent study conducted by Linkedin wherein
they examined the freelance economy on their
site.
2. What are the top industries for freelancing?
Based on the number of members who used
the keyword “freelance” within their job title,
LinkedIn was able to narrow down the most
common industries and sets of skills among
this category.
Almost half of the members fall under “Arts
& Design”. 46% of the members specialize in
various things under this industry, be it fine
arts, graphic design, illustrators, makeup
artists, musicians, and more.
3. What makes freelancers unique?
Given the fact that both professional
freelancers and non-freelancers have a
certain set of skills and characteristics, the
next step was to see how different the two
really are.
On average, LinkedIn’s data shows that
freelancers handle around 2-3 projects at
once. Because of the flexible nature of this
career path, people have the choice to juggle
as many projects they can handle and even
balance them with full-time job.
4. There are overall more males on LinkedIn but
according to the data, females were more
likely to take up freelance projects than male.
Their data also shows that freelancers on
average have more recommendations, group
memberships, skills listed, endorsements,
and connections.
